Gatecount is the turnstile counter service for the Ferrowick Arena deployments. We run three environments: dev (shared, reset nightly), staging (mirrors production hardware counts), and production (live match days only). Staging receives replayed turnstile events from the previous fixture, so throughput numbers there are realistic. New contractors should only deploy to dev until Priya signs off on your first change. Each environment reads its settings from a mounted config map at boot. The staging values are listed below.

deployment values, yahag-tawef:
ZORWYN_HOST=zorwyn.tolvaqlabs.internal
ZORWYN_PORT=9300

## TICKET: Signature verification failing on SweepStray deploy

Severity: high. The orphaned-resource sweeper (SweepStray v3.2) fails its signature check during rollout to the Corvane cluster. The verifier reports a key mismatch; the pipeline appears to reference the pre-rotation key. Please confirm the deploy host's keyring was updated after last week's rotation. For verification, the current deploy key is below.

signing key of bagap-yawep = bky13_TbfT6ZMUoGJo2

- [ ] Data-centre cage visit. On your first day, your team lead walks you through the Brickfell Hall server room so you can see the Orova cage layout. Wear closed shoes; no bags inside the cage. Sign the rack log before touching any hardware. The cage door has a keypad rather than a badge reader, so you will need the code below.

turnstile pass: bdg-FVNQRS-72965873